Does textarea have innerHTML?

Does textarea have innerHTML?

For div and span, you can use innerHTML, but for textarea use value. Please see the example below.

Can we use value in textarea?

A textarea doesn’t have a value attribute, unlike an input field. With plain JavaScript, you can use either innerHTML , innerText or textContent to write text inside a textarea.

What is textarea value?

The textarea element represents a field for multi-line text input. textarea controls are useful to collect or edit long runs of text like messages, files’ contents, lists, reviews, articles, etc. The content of this element represents the initial value of the control.

How get textarea value in react?

so you can get that data on submit. In this example, we will take simple “body” input textarea field and add onchange event with handleChange() then we will assign value on state variable array. Then on submit event we will take that values with state variable.

How do I use textarea in react?

Using textarea as HTML Input Type

  1. To make a textarea in React, use the input tag.
  2. Notice that textarea is used as a type with the input form control, and as soon as the user changes the value, it’s used for the rendering process.

Which defines a textarea?

The tag defines a multi-line text input control. A text area can hold an unlimited number of characters, and the text renders in a fixed-width font (usually Courier). The size of a text area is specified by the and attributes (or with CSS).

How can I fix my textarea size?

To prevent a text field from being resized, you can use the CSS resize property with its “none” value. After it you can use the height and width properties to define a fixed height and width for your element.

How can I get default value of textarea?

The defaultValue property sets or returns the default value of a text area. Note: The default value of a text area is the text between the and tags.

How do you select an element in React?

To select a default option in React, the selected attribute is used in the option element. In React, though, instead of using the selected attribute, the value prop is used on the root select element. So, you can set a default value by passing the value of the option in the value prop of the select input element.

How to use the textarea value property in HTML?

Textarea value Property 1 Definition and Usage. The value property sets or returns the contents of a text area. 2 Browser Support 3 Syntax 4 Property Values 5 Technical Details 6 More Examples

What’s the difference between innerHTML and value in HTML?

.value gives you the currently-set value of a form element (input, select, textarea), whereas .innerHTML builds an HTML string based on the DOM nodes the element contains.

How to get contents of textarea in JavaScript?

For textarea, you could only use .value in your scenario (I tested your given code and it works fine). . 1) keep in mind that you call this function addProduct () ONLY after your element is mentioned in the code, otherwise it will be undefined.

What does the value of a text area do?

The value property sets or returns the contents of a text area. Note: The value of a text area is the text between the and tags.

Does textarea have innerHTML? For div and span, you can use innerHTML, but for textarea use value. Please see the example below. Can we use value in textarea? A textarea doesn’t have a value attribute, unlike an input field. With plain JavaScript, you can use either innerHTML , innerText or textContent to write text inside…